Can I live in Davao on $1,500/month?
Living in Davao on $1,500/mo is rated "Comfortable". Budget allocates ~$482 to rent, $548 to groceries, $165 to dining.
Can I live in Incheon on $1,500/month?
In Incheon, $1,500/mo is rated "Moderate". Allocations: $558 rent, $536 groceries, $131 dining.
Is Davao or Incheon cheaper?
Davao is generally cheaper. COL+Rent: Davao 14 vs Incheon 34.7 (NYC=100).
What is $1,500/mo in Davao worth in Incheon?
$1,500/mo of purchasing power in Davao equals ~$3,718/mo in Incheon using COL adjustment.
